Average Personal Financial Advisors Salary in Racine-Mount Pleasant, WI

The average salary for a Personal Financial Advisors in Racine-Mount Pleasant, WI is $148,950.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market.

How much does a Personal Financial Advisors make in Racine-Mount Pleasant, WI?

The median annual salary for a Personal Financial Advisors in Racine-Mount Pleasant, WI is $148,950. This typically ranges from $58,310 for entry-level positions to $223,425 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Racine-Mount Pleasant, WI is 7.1% lower than the national median of $160,360.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 70 employees in the Racine-Mount Pleasant, WI area with a job density of 0.888 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
